titleOfInvention | An online energy dispersive x-ray diffraction analyser |
abstract | An on-line EDXRD analyser including (i) a housing defining an analysis zone and having a passageway through it to allow transport of material in a process stream to pass through the analysis zone, (ii) a collimated source of polychromatic X-rays, (iii) an energy-resolving (ER)X-ray detector, (iv) a primary beam collimator disposed between the source of X-rays and the (ER)X-ray detector comprising an annular slit which defines an incident beam of polychromatic X-rays to irradiate a portion of the analysis zone, (v) a scatter collimator disposed between the primary beam collimator and the ERX-ray detector, the scatter collimator comprising an annular slit which defines a diffracted beam of X-rays scattered by the material to converge towards the ERX-ray detector, and (vi) a detector collimator comprising a conical opening which further defines the diffracted beam of X-rays scattered by the material. The ERX-ray detector measures an energy spectrum of the diffracted X-rays at a predetermined diffraction angle defined by the relative positioning of (ii) to (vi), and where one of (iv) and (v) comprises an aperture arranged to enable a detector to measure the transmission of a direct beam of X-rays through the material. |
